Terra Madre 2016: Delegates have been chosen!

May 31, 2016 by

It’s hard to believe that the next edition of Terra Madre Salone del Gusto (TMSdG) is just a few short months away. We’ve now chosen our delegates and are extremely proud of the fantastic group we’ve assembled. Our delegation represents our country from coast to coast to coast (!) and is full of both experience and youth Slow Food members who’ll work together to take our Canadian presence to the next level. We’ve got Slow Meat and Slow Fish delegates, farmers, foragers, cheesemakers, chefs, culinary students, bakers, educators, and community food activists and organizers – all passionate and committed to the ongoing work of Slow Food in Canada. We can’t wait to see what they achieve in Turin! Auguri!
